      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hi Luciano, thanks for the log. I noticed that you are using Qlik Sense 2.2, there is a newly identified bug in 2.2 that is breaking the script. The FileSize function does not &lt;SPAN style="font-size: 13.3333px;"&gt;recognise wild cards&lt;/SPAN&gt; anymore. QDF is using the vL.FileExist function to validate content, this function is broken due to the bug. Ive attached a workaround, just for 2.2 version (hoping the bug gets fixed instead of changing code in general). Just replace 1.FileExist.qvs in all containers with the one attached.
